Abstract

To repair the internal thread (2b) of a large diameter orifice, an added thread is screwed into the orifice in a form wound on a threaded part of the surface of a drum screwed into an internally threaded centering ring engaged in the entry part (2a) of the orifice (2). The thread is laid against the internal thread (2b) and fastened in place by installing a pin passing through the thread and engaged in the wall of the orifice (2). The process is used for repairing the internal threads of orifices (2) machined in the flange of a pressurized-water nuclear reactor vessel, allowing the vessel cover to be bolted down sealingly.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. Process for installing a helical added thread in a large diameter orifice for repairing an internal thread of said orifice, said process comprising the steps of (a) providing a cylindrical drum having an at least partly threaded external surface;   (b) engaging and winding said added thread on a threaded part of said external surface of said drum;   (c) providing a centering ring having a threaded internal surface and an engagement end part;   (d) engaging and maintaining said engagement end part of said centering ring in an entry part of said orifice, so that said threaded internal surface of said centering ring constitutes an extension of said internal thread of said orifice;   (e) screwing said drum on which said added thread is wound onto said threaded internal surface of said centering ring and then into said internal thread of said orifice;   (f) laying said added thread against said internal thread of said orifice; and   (g) fastening said added thread in place by passing a pin through the thread and engaging said pin in an internal wall of said orifice.   
     
     
       2. Process according to claim 1, wherein said added thread consists of a material having a hardness substantially higher than the hardness of the material forming said wall of said orifice and of the material of a fastening element to be screwed into said orifice. 
     
     
       3. Process according to claim 1 or 2, wherein said added thread consists of a winding with continuous turns, said winding having the length which corresponds substantially to a length of the thread of said internal thread which is being repaired. 
     
     
       4. Process according to claim 1 or 2, wherein said added thread has an end flight bent towards the inside of said added thread in a substantially radial arrangement. 
     
     
       5. Process according to claim 1 or 2, wherein said thread has a cross-section in the form of a parallelogram with rounded angles.
